智能产品开发,从创意到落地的探索之旅
本篇心得详细回顾了智能产品开发的全过程,从创意阶段至落地实施,展现了团队在技术、设计和市场等方面的努力与突破,团队通过深入调研用户需求,把握了产品的核心痛点,为产品设计提供了科学依据,随后,团队团队在产品设计和技术创新上不断突破,最终完成了多功能智能产品的设计与开发,在产品迭代过程中,团队注重用户体验的优化,通过用户测试和数据分析,确保了产品在功能与性能上达到最佳平衡,团队在落地过程中,注重与市场的对接,通过市场反馈及时调整产品参数,最终实现了产品从“概念”到“市场”的成功转化。
本文目录导读:

智能产品开发,这个看似神秘但实则充满智慧的过程,让我在 years 的实践中,逐渐体会到创意与技术、用户需求与产品设计之间的深刻联系,每一次开发 decide,每一次迭代优化,都是一次对智能产品的探索之旅。
需求分析:从模糊到清晰
智能产品的开发,最开始的一步就是明确需求,用户对产品的期望往往以模糊的形式呈现,智能系统需要在 24 小时内稳定运行",但真正意义上的需求分析,需要我们转化为清晰的、具体的、可量化的指标。
在开发过程中,我常常会遇到这样的问题:用户期望的产品界面是否友好,系统能否在各种复杂场景下正常运行,数据处理是否高效等等,这些问题都需要通过深入的用户调研,转化为明确的需求维度,才能确保开发方向符合用户的实际需求。
开发流程:从草图到原型
开发流程是一个充满挑战的过程,从需求分析到功能设计,再到原型开发,每一个步骤都需要细致入微的思考与实践。
在功能设计阶段,我常常会遇到技术难题,如何高效实现复杂的数据交互,如何确保系统性能不受压力,这时候,我就会想到使用现成的开源库,比如React Native 或 Vue.js,来简化代码写法,提高开发效率。
原型开发是最终验证产品是否符合预期的重要环节,在设计完功能架构后,我需要通过多种形式的测试(如 UI 测试、数据输入测试等)来确认产品是否符合预期,每次测试都是一次对产品的深入探索,最终帮助我发现并解决可能的问题。
技术选择:从现有技术到创新设计
技术选择是智能产品开发的基础,我选择了 React Native 和 Next.js,这两大技术让我能够高效地实现复杂的交互和数据管理。
React Native 的优势在于,它将 React 和 Node.js 的API整合到单一的开发环境中,极大地提升了开发效率,而 Next.js 则提供了强大的数据存储和管理能力,让我能够轻松处理大量的数据和业务逻辑。
创新设计方面,我特别关注用户体验,力求让产品在简洁性与功能性之间找到平衡,我设计了一个基于 React 的智能天线,通过实时调整方向,以适应移动环境的变化。
实际应用:从设计到落地
在实际应用中,我遇到了不少挑战,如何在有限的预算内实现功能的扩展性,如何在复杂的数据处理过程中保持系统稳定运行等等。
通过与团队的紧密合作,我逐步解决了这些问题,我通过引入中间件技术,将复杂的业务逻辑分解为多个独立的功能,从而实现了系统的扩展性。
成功经验:从失败到成长
在开发过程中,我经历了多次失败和成功,最开始的失败主要来自对技术难度的忽视,后来通过不断的优化和学习,最终实现了产品的成功。
从失败中我可以学到很多东西,我第一次尝试在 React 中实现一个复杂的交互,结果运行缓慢,后来,我意识到需要优化代码结构,重新设计了功能架构,这种失败的成功经验,让我明白,技术的不断学习与探索是成功的关键。
挑战与启示
开发过程中的挑战包括技术难度、资金限制和时间压力等,我最初在选用了哪种开发工具时,花费了大量时间进行测试与优化,后来,我通过学习和调整工具,最终解决了问题。
在挑战中,我学会了如何面对复杂的问题,并且通过团队合作和持续学习,逐步克服了困难,这让我明白,技术开发需要持续的努力与耐心。
总结与展望
通过这次智能产品开发的经历,我收获了很多宝贵的经验,从需求分析到开发流程的设计,从技术选择到实际应用,每一个环节都让我受益匪浅。
展望未来,智能产品的发展趋势非常广阔,随着人工智能技术的不断进步,智能产品的智能化水平将不断提升,企业需求的多样化也带来了开发效率的提升。
我将继续在智能产品开发的道路上,探索更多的可能性,为用户提供更优质的产品体验。